Mount Abu, Rajasthan's only hill station, is pleasant year-round. Best April to June as a heat escape and September to November for post-monsoon clarity.

Mount Abu Summer Festival
May/June
Cultural festival with folk music, boat race on Nakki Lake, and Sham-e-Qawwali.

Monsoon in Mount Abu (20-28°C): Moderate rainfall. Lush green hills. Waterfalls active. Some road disruptions possible. Crowds are medium, pricing is moderate. Carry rain gear and expect some slippery conditions at outdoor sites.

Winter in Mount Abu (10-28°C): Pleasant but cool nights. Sunset Point and Guru Shikhar visits are comfortable. Pack layers, a warm jacket, and expect chilly mornings. Most travelers consider this the most atmospheric time to visit.
